404 Not Found
Please forward this error screen to www.chinarate.org's WebMaster.

The server can not find the requested page:

  • www.chinarate.org/%E8%8B%B1%E9%95%91%E5%AF%B9%E4%BA%BA%E6%B0%91%E5%B8%81%E6%B1%87%E7%8E%87_%E4%BB%8A%E6%97%A5%E8%8B%B1%E9%95%91%E5%85%91%E6%8D%A2%E4%BA%BA%E6%B0%91%E5%B8%81%E6%B1%87%E7%8E%87%E8%A1%A8_%E8%8B%B1%E9%95%91%E5%92%8C%E4%BA%BA%E6%B0%91%E5%B8%81%E6%B1%87%E7%8E%87_%E6%B1%87%E7%8E%87%E7%BD%91 (port 80)